I enjoyed Amy Scattergood’s article “Oh, Get Past the Garnish” [May 10]. A very enjoyable read, it was fresh in subject matter and writing.

I will never think about mint jelly again without imagining its “wobbly sweetness,” and I’ll remember “a garnish is what the IRS can do to your wages” next time I see a lonely sprig of parsley sitting on my dinner plate.

SUSAN BECKMAN

Venice

I really enjoyed reading the last few articles by Amy Scattergood and last week’s piece regarding parsley, cilantro, et al. Scattergood has a very engaging writing style that is atypical of most of the food writers I am familiar with.

I almost canceled my subscription after Jim Murray passed, but now I have a new favorite writer to look for.

MRS. NORMAN APPLEBAUM

West Los Angeles
